What Ethical SEO Really Means Today:
Ethical SEO is often misunderstood. It doesn’t mean slow growth. It doesn’t mean ignoring algorithms. It means aligning growth with real user value.
At its core, ethical SEO focuses on:
- Understanding genuine search intent
- Creating content that solves real problems
- Fixing technical foundations before chasing traffic
- Measuring success through user engagement, not vanity metrics
Search engines have evolved for one simple reason — to reward helpful experiences. When your strategy respects users first, algorithms usually follow.

Practical Lessons for Business Owners & Marketers
Here are a few lessons I’ve learned that apply across industries:
1. Don’t Chase Rankings — Chase Relevance
If your content doesn’t help users, rankings won’t sustain.
2. Fix Foundations Before Scaling
Technical SEO, site structure, and UX come before content volume.
3. Traffic Without Intent Is Just a Number
Focus on meaningful engagement, not just clicks.
4. SEO Is a Process, Not a Campaign
Real growth comes from iteration, testing, and patience.
5. Choose Partners Who Think Long-Term
Growth partners should align with your vision, not shortcuts.
These principles work whether you’re a startup, a local business, or an established brand.
